The ESA Agriculture Science Cluster aims at promoting networking, collaborative research, and fostering international collaboration in Agriculture science. It involves different ESA funded projects and activities bringing together different expertise, data and resources in a synergistic manner ensuring that the final result may be bigger than the sum of the parts. With this approach ESA wants to contribute to establish an stronger European Agriculture research area in close collaboration with the European Commission Directorate General for Research and Innovation and other European and international partners.
